`

FreeBSD 环境准备

阅读更多

1.    修改SSH设置,用SSH连接主机,比较方便。该项可以再安装FreeBSD的时候可以选择支持SSH的。如果当时没有选择。那按如下配置
a.    /etc/inetd.conf,去掉ssh前的#,保存退出
b.    编辑/etc/rc.conf, 最后加入:sshd_enable="yes"即可

c.    vi /etc/group 加入需要远程登录的用户到sshd中,最好是一个wheel组的用户到,例如sshd:*:22:admin

d. 在其他的机器,例如windows机器使用Putty 就可以远程访问该服务器了。Putty下载地址

http://www.chiark.greenend.org.uk/~sgtatham/putty/download.html

 

2.    修改最快的镜像地址:

vim /etc/make.conf加入国内最新的源地址(可搜索freebsd make.conf):
MASTER_SITE_OVERRIDE?= \
http://ports.cn.freebsd.org/${DIST_SUBDIR}/\
ftp://ftp.freebsdchina.org/pub/FreeBSD/ports/distfiles/${DIST_SUBDIR}/ \
ftp://ftp.freebsd.org.cn/pub/FreeBSD/ports/distfiles/${DIST_SUBDIR} /\  

 

3.安装bash,设置用户使用bash
cd /usr/ports/shells/bash
make install  clean
chsh –s /usr/local/bin/bash(其中/usr/local/bin/bash为bash应用程序的路径)

 

4.    安装文件高亮显示功能
首先需要安装gnuls

cd /usr/ports/misc/gnuls/ && make install clean

安装完成后

cd /etc
vi profile, 添加以下
alias ls='ls -G' #显示颜色

alias ll='ls -l'
alias la='ls -al'
alias rm='rm -i' #确认删除
alias mv='mv -i' #确认移动
alias cp=’cp -i’#复制确认

 

5.    设置环境变量
最好的中文设置方法(参考Freebsd手册):

a.    打开#vi  /etc/login.conf
b.    查找到”root:\”字段,设置编码:
	root:\
	:ignore.......:\
	:charset=UTF-8:\
	:lang=zh_CN.UTF-8:\
	:tc=default:
c.    输入#cap_mkdb /etc/login.conf
d.    重启系统,输入#locale  则可以看到刚更改的效果


6.升级ports,

如果是第一次的话,是先执行portsnap fetch,然后执行portsnap extract
如果不是第一次的话,只需要执行portsnap fetch update,就可以实现得到最新的ports了。portsnap下载下的压缩文件是保存在目录/var/db /portsnap/中

分享到:
评论

相关推荐

    FreeBSD使用大全

    X Window下的中文环境 中文X应用软件 外挂式中文显示与输入软件 中文X服务器 配置文件XF86Config 第6章 定制应用软件与系统内核 编译应用软件 Ports Collection 手工编译安装程序 可执行程序格式 配置FreeBSD...

    runj:runj是针对FreeBSD监狱的,实验性,概念验证的OCI兼容运行时

    runj当前支持OCI运行时规范的以下部分: 指令创造删除开始状态杀设定档根路径处理参数Craft.io环境Craft.io终端入门OCI捆绑要使用runj入狱,您必须准备一个OCI捆绑包。 捆绑包由一个根文件系统和一个JSON格式的配置...

    DM8安装手册.pdf

    达梦数据库管理系统(以下简称 DM) 是基于客户/服务器方式的...装开始之前,首先应该检查所得到的 DM 产品是否完整,并准备好 DM 所需的硬件环境、 软件环境。 本章主要介绍在安装 DM 产品前需要进行的准备工作。

    freeRadius安装配置说明书 完全文档

    通过测试安装,讲述了在linux环境下安装freeRadius的准备条件以及安装步骤。

    FreeNAS 开发人员手册

    2.1 定义系统环境变量 2.2 创建根文件系统 2.2.1 创建工作目录 2.2.2 生成最小root文件系统 2.3 拷贝需要的二进制文件 2.4 准备/etc 2.4.1 安装etc和PHP配置脚本 2.4.2 其他注意事项 (自己写,未验证) ...

    Unitial::desktop_computer:我的rc配置dotfiles:open_file_folder:

    在其他unix环境中,请准备curl或wget ,以便安装脚本可以正确下载其他文件。安装如果您有curl通过此一行命令安装: curl -Lo- https://github.com/PeterDaveHello/Unitial/raw/master/setup.sh | bash 如果您没有...

    vagrant-opnsense:引导OPNsense插件开发环境的Vagrant项目

    引导OPNsense插件开发环境的Vagrant项目 要求 能够运行VirtualBox的系统 准备 在VirtualBox中创建一个仅主机的网络,其IP地址为192.168.1.0/24而不是192.168.1.1 。 默认情况下,这是您的OPNsense将用于LAN接口的...

    异新优商城内容系统 v1.0.zip

    异新优商城内容系统可以在 Linux、WINDOWS、FreeBSD 服务器环境中运行,系统是在ubuntu环境中开发完成 ,建议使用linux系统,免费、安全、配置简单、性能强悍。 异新优商城内容系统安装步骤: 第一步、解压异新优...

    easttownbbs:国立东华大学-东方小城-电子布告栏系统(NDHU EastTown BBS)

    建议环境 Ubuntu Server 12.04.5 LTS CentOS 6.6 Final FreeBSD 8.4R 对于Ubuntu Server用户,只需执行setup_bbs_ubuntu.sh ,就可以了! 安装前 您应该始终...在进行更改之前,请备份并重新检查!!! 准备 对于...

    小说网源码

    安装程序前请先准备好web服务环境,做好域名解析,并拥有mysql数据库账号 1.运行你的域名/diguo 账号admin 密码123456 (帝国备份王 不会使用百度下) 恢复数据库文件 xiaoshuo_20120906104052 2.修改/configs/...

    ShopNC电商平台系统最新破解版

    一、ShopNC【B2B2C】电商系统具备跨平台特性,可运行于 Linux/FreeBSD/Unix 及微软 Windows 2000/2003/XP/NT 等各种操作系统环境下。我们已在软件中针对上述操作系统做了大量的测试和实地检验,保证 ShopNC【B2B2C】...

    08CMS小说系统模型 繁体UTF8版.rar

    08CMS 具备跨平台特性,可以运行于 Linux/FreeBSD/Unix 及微软 Windows 2000/2003/2008 等各种操作系统环境下。我们已在软件中针对上述操作系统做了大量的测试和实地检验,保证 08CMS 可以在上述系统中安全稳定的...

    08CMS小说系统模型 简体GBK版.rar

    08CMS 具备跨平台特性,可以运行于 Linux/FreeBSD/Unix 及微软 Windows 2000/2003/2008 等各种操作系统环境下。我们已在软件中针对上述操作系统做了大量的测试和实地检验,保证 08CMS 可以在上述系统中安全稳定的...

    reLCS-Separate-Version-:re3的reLCS单独存储库

    准备建筑环境 如果希望通过后构建脚本将可执行文件移动到GTA LCS根文件夹,则可能需要将GTA_LCS_RE_DIR环境变量指向GTA LCS根文件夹。 对于Linux,请继续: 对于FreeBSD,请继续: 对于Windows,假设您具有Visual ...

    MolyX Board 2.0 个人用户版

    1. 系统需求 操作系统: Windows, *nix, FREEBSD等 网络环境: Apache, IIS等标准网络环境 数据库: MySQL 脚本语言: PHP<br> 其他需求: Zend Optimizer 2.01+ (www.zend.com) 2. 文件上传...

    nims-visit-2014:在 NIMS 访问 NIST 时题为“仿真管理工具”的演讲幻灯片

    幻灯片是使用和准备的。 执照 该存储库使用 FreeBSD 许可证获得许可,请参阅 。 要求 文件包含开发过程中 Python 环境中的完整包列表。 列出了其中最重要的。 版本号在合理范围内通常并不重要,但如果您遇到问题,...

Global site tag (gtag.js) - Google Analytics